Managing display of detachable windows in a GUI computing environment

Last updated:

Abstract:

A system and method for facilitating user interaction with a software application. An example method includes displaying a first primary window of an application; providing a user option to select a sub-window of the first primary window, resulting in generation of a detached window corresponding to the sub-window in response thereto; leaving a first user interface control in the first primary window in place of the sub-window, wherein the first user interface control provides a first user option to implement a first action pertaining to the detached window; and including a second user interface control in proximity to the detached window, wherein the second user interface control provides a first user option to implement a second action applicable to the detached window and primary window. The user interface controls may be implemented via headers in the primary window and detached window. Data is automatically synchronized between windows.
